Immigrant Smuggling Bust

Phoenix police have uncovered a large illegal immigrant smuggling house.

They received a report from a man who had been held with 60 other illegal immigrants in a central Phoenix house. Four smugglers allegedly held the group and attempted to extort money from their families.

One of the immigrants was allegedly also sexually assaulted by a smuggler. Phoenix police have arrested 20-year-old Fabian Franco on one count of sexual assault.

The smuggling part of the case was handed over to the Immigration and Naturalization Service.

But Phoenix police spokesman Tony Morales says these type of kidnapping and extortion cases are becoming increasingly common. They are rarely reported though.

Police Bust House With 60 Immigrants

PHOENIX (AP)--About 60 illegal immigrants were held hostage in a Phoenix house while smugglers demanded payment from their families, police said Wednesday.

Police said a man who was allegedly being held at the house escaped Tuesday and called 911. Investigators found about 60 immigrants and four smugglers in the home, Detective Tony Morales said.

One of the smugglers was booked on suspicion of sexually assaulting a woman held at the house.

Except for the victim and assailant, everyone found in the house was turned over to immigration authorities, police said.

The immigrants reported paying $200 to $2,200 to be smuggled into the United States, INS spokesman Russell Ahr said. He added that he did not know whether the alleged smugglers were in the group that was detained, or whether any of them would face kidnapping charges.

Local and federal law enforcement officials have said that a growing number of smugglers are holding illegal immigrants for ransom. The cases are rarely reported because victims fear deportation.
